Transaction 6630bf4c271d7b132fc02e256578e18557d35e276cff895f3b4baeee131551b7
1 Input
1 Output
-
6630bf4c271d7b132fc02e256578e18557d35e276cff895f3b4baeee131551b7:0
- value
- 20846
- script pubkey
- OP_0 OP_PUSHBYTES_20 76a545c60f48b50879ae9a16b1c177d77b97be8a
- address
- bc1qw6j5t3s0fz6ss7dwngttrsth6aae0052sldck9